To
properly apply a standard tube insert, the distance from the end of the
profile to the center of the
first mounting hole must be .750”. This also means that by using
the pre-manufactured hole pattern in the profile, your cut lengths are required to be divisible by 1.50”.
For lengths other than those divisible by
1.50” there are two options available.
The
second option, shown in the illustration below, illustrates the use of
an Extended
Tube Insert in the profile end that has
the irregular hole spacing. This extended
insert is located at the second
pre-manufactured hole instead of the first
and will also require the use of a 3.50" connector bolt for fastening
the two profiles together.
